Northern MB Travel Restrictions

The province is bringing back travel restrictions to Northern Manitoba due to the increasing number of cases in the south.

 

The travel restrictions will take effect this Thursday.

 

In addition to these restrictions, all Manitobans are asked to respect any restrictions that First Nation communities have in place.

 

MKO Grand Chief Garrison Settee commended Manitoba’s Chief Public Health Officer Doctor Brent Roussin for working closely with northern First Nations to protect citizens from COVID-19.

 

Settee goes on to thank Roussin and the province for listening to First Nations Leadership and putting these measures in place.

 

The orders prohibiting travel to northern Manitoba will have exceptions, and MKO says it will share more information about the details of the order once they become available.
